We are seeking a highly skilled Infection Preventionist for MGB Medical Group. The Infection Preventionist is responsible for the day-to-day implementation of the Infection Prevention functions of MGB MG IC, one of the site teams of MGB Infection Control. The Infection Preventionist, reporting to the SR Manager of Infection Control at MGB MG, must have knowledge and experience in infection prevention and control principles and practice, the ability to reputed company evidence-based decisions, excellent problem-solving skills, and excellent written and oral communication skills. In this role, the Infection Preventionist implements system-wide infection prevention and control goals, policies, and standards at the site level while ensuring alignment with clinical, administrative, and regulatory requirements. The position leads NHSN and non-NHSN surveillance, outbreak detection, remediation, and reporting activities, and conducts regular Environment of Care rounds with timely communication of findings to local and system leaders. The role supports reputed company improvement efforts, evaluates site-specific infection risks, and develops strategies to reduce transmission. This individual serves as a liaison to regulatory and public health agencies, oversees infection prevention education, and collaborates closely with Occupational Health and key stakeholders such as Environmental Health and Safety, Compliance, Facilities, and Real Estate. Additional responsibilities include acting as NHSN site administrator reputed company designated, participating in IPCC working groups, and completing other duties as assigned. Job Summary Summary Responsible for the coordination and planning of Infection Control activities. Provides guidance and consultation in the development, planning, and coordination of infection control. Conducts relevant investigations and reputed company reports pertinent to clinical risk management issues. Does this position require Patient Care? Yes Essential Functions -Report communicable diseases to local and state health departments and complete public health department forms as needed -Utilize performance improvement methodology as a means of enacting change. -Develops an annual surveillance plan based on the population(s) served, services provided, and analysis of surveillance data. -Maintains records of actual potentially infectious patients and reports pertinent information to county, state, and federal agencies as required by law. -Provides formal and informal education programs to hospital personnel as necessary or reputed company directed.
